Ash emission was observed from Kanlaon Volcano early Wednesday evening, according to the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ology (PHIVOLCS).

The emission occurred at 6:02 p.m., Wednesday, September 9, 2026.

"The event generated a grayish plume that rose 500 meters above the summit crater before drifting northeast, as visually recorded by the Canlaon City Observation Station (KVO-CC)," PHIVOLCS reported.

The agency added that Alert Level 2 remains in effect over Kanlaon Volcano. — BAP, GMA News
